Job Summary

We are seeking an Internal Medicine or Family Medicine trained physician to join us in pursuit of high quality patient care to provide a full scope of primary care services including but not limited to diagnosis, treatment, coordination of care, preventive care and health maintenance.

Responsibilities

  • Review patient’s history and perform physical examinations.  Evaluate, diagnose and provide appropriate treatment and patient care.  Prefer patient to specialist as needed.
  • Provide quality clinical diagnostic skills in the delivery of patient care.  Review all test results and recommend suitable management for the patient, including but not limited to, preventive health recommendations and habits.
  • Prescribe medications and formulate ongoing treatment and disease management plans.
  • Provide relationship-centered care, taking into account the patient’s psychosocial and physical needs.
  • Collect and record patient information, such as medical histories, reports and examination results.  Maintain complete and accurate medical records.
  • Communicate effectively with the clinical team to insure total delivery of quality care.
  • Participate in medical staff educational programs and meetings. 

Qualifications 

  • Doctor of Medicine (MD), Doctor of Osteopathy (DO) or foreign equivalent
  • Completion of three year post graduate medical training from a U.S. accredited residency program in Internal Medicine and or Family Medicine
  • Seeking both experienced and newly trained providers
  • Board Eligible/Board Certified in Internal Medicine
  • Must possess current, unrestricted New York State license or be eligible for licensure.
  • Must possess active Drug Enforcement Agency (DEA) registration or be eligible for registration
  • Must possess active Medicare/Medicaid Enrollment or be eligible to enroll
  • BLS or ACLS strongly preferred
  • Must possess strong communication skills both oral and written
  • Comfortable with Electronic Medical Record (EMR) system and Microsoft Office
